Ingredients
2 tablespoons olive oil
4 tablespoons butter (divided)
4-5 cloves garlic, minced
1 1/4 pounds shrimp, peeled and deveined
1 pinch salt and black pepper
1/4 cup vegetable broth
1/2 teaspoon red pepper flakes
2 tablespoons fresh lemon juice
1/4 cup fresh parsley, chopped
Instructions
Heat the olive oil and 2 tablespoons of butter in a large skillet over medium-high heat.
Add the minced garlic and sauté for 30 seconds until fragrant.
Add the shrimp to the pan in a single layer.
Season with salt and pepper.
Sauté for 2 minutes on the first side until pink edges appear.
Flip the shrimp and cook until just opaque.
Add the vegetable broth, remaining 2 tablespoons of butter, lemon juice, and red pepper flakes to the pan.
Whisk or stir gently to emulsify the sauce.
Remove from heat immediately and garnish with fresh parsley.
Notes
Ensure the shrimp are dry before searing to get a better crust. Serve immediately over pasta, crusty bread, or zucchini noodles for a lower-carb option. Do not overcook the shrimp, as they can quickly become rubbery.
